Feeling that you or the room are spinning can be a very debilitating problem. But as scary as this may seem, most times it’s a very simple problem to fix. If the symptoms last less than two minutes, and only happen when you’re in specific positions, such as rolling in bed or bending over, it’s likely a condition referred to as BPPV(Benign Paroxysmal Positional Vertigo). BPPV occurs when calcium crystals in the inner ear get stuck in the wrong area. This can result from a hit to the head or can happen with no apparent reason. A vestibular physiotherapist can diagnose BPPV with some simple testing. Treatment typically involves specific head positioning combined with rolling, and the problem may even be resolved after the first session. But usually, it takes three or four tries.
